Bare Knuckle Fighting Championship is rapidly expanding, with a major boost expected from a potential Conor McGregor fight. BKFC President David Feldman is extremely confident that McGregor will compete in the organization after his next UFC bout. Conor McGregor, who took on an ownership stake in Bare Knuckle Fighting Championship (BKFC) in April 2024, suffered a knee injury during his UFC 329 bout in July, with plans for his return to competition still pending. Feldman noted McGregor's intense focus despite his recovery.

It seems inevitable that it will occur at some point, according to BKFC president David Feldman. I caught up with Feldman, who shared his thoughts on McGregor's prospects moving forward and the other events in store. Let's talk bare knuckle.
Feldman put it plainly. 'I really, really would bet my house that you see Conor McGregor fighting BKFC after his next fight,' he said. He had spoken to McGregor the night before and described him as more focused than he had ever seen him.

McGregor came back to fight at UFC 329 on July 11, but injured his knee in the opening seconds of his fight with Max Holloway. McGregor has had successful knee surgery and he expects to return to the Octagon to complete the final fight on his contract.
McGregor has been a part-owner of BKFC since April 2024. He last fought at UFC 329 in July, losing to Max Holloway
